It is hard to describe how to square up blocks, you want to do so without losing points or having lopsided squares.

I try moving the square up ruler around the block, auditioning different places that I "could" make the cuts.

With the D9P, I would probably start by placing the ruler in the center of the block, lining up seam lines with the rulers markings. This ensures that your block won't end up "wonky." I would try to cut the same amount of fabric off, all the way around the block.

If you placed the ruler in one corner and started cutting, two sides would have squares that are smaller than the other two sides.
